EVIDENCE OF GROWTH STIMULATION BY LOW CONCENTRATION OF GIBBERELLIN SYNTHESIS INHIBITORS

摘要

There are several compounds used in ornamental production systems and in the care and maintenance of trees in urban landscapes because they are known in inhibit the synthesis of gibberellins via the isoprenoid pathway when applied at labeled rates. The consequence of this effect on plants is typically reduction of vegetative growth with a re-partitioning of assimilates to reproductive growth and fine root development. However, at low concentrations that may arise due to environmental degradation or misapplication of applied compounds, growth stimulation may occur. Examples of stimulation of growth in plants and a possible explanation for this seemingly anomalous response related to energy production in mitochondria via the electron transport chain are presented.
